Columbia MBA Placement Report: Employment Outcomes
The Class of 2024 demonstrates strong placement performance.
Job Offer and Acceptance Rates
- 89% received job offers within 3 months
- 86.4% accepted offers within 3 months
This reflects strong employer demand for Columbia MBA graduates.
Columbia MBA Placement Report: Salary and Compensation
Columbia MBA graduates earn among the highest salaries globally.
- Median Base Salary: $175,000
- Median Signing Bonus: $30,000
- Median Additional Compensation: $21,185
- Highest Salary: Up to $370,000
Compensation is strongest in consulting, finance, and technology roles.

Columbia MBA Placement Report: Geographic Distribution
- United States: ~79%
- Asia: ~9%
- Europe: ~5%
- Central & South America: ~4%
- Africa & Middle East: ~3%
Graduates secure roles globally across major markets.
